India: With 100,000 students, Maharishi Vidya Mandir Schools uphold excellence through Consciousness-Based Education

3 July 2012

Maharishi Vidya Mandir Schools Group in India now has 148 branches with more than 100,000 students, 4,000 teachers, and 2,000 support and administrative staff, in 16 states. 'The largest chain of privately owned schools in India', it is also the largest project of Maharishi Mahesh Yogi's worldwide organizations, said Dr Girish C. Varma, Chairman.

Dr Varma, who is also Director-General of the Global Capital of World Peace at the Brahmasthan (geographical centre) of India, and director of Maharishi's programmes in the nation, described the progress and achievements of Maharishi Vidya Mandir Schools over the past year.

In this academic year, as in previous years, Maharishi Vidya Mandir Schools and teachers have added a large number of state, national and international achievements, awards, and honours to the organization's renown. 'Hundreds of our students have received merit positions in national and state education board exams, talent search exams, various subject olympiads, and a large number have successfully qualified in many reputed national and international qualifying test exams.'

This is the second year, Dr Varma said, that 100 per cent of Maharishi Vidya Mandir Schools are continuing to implement Consciousness-Based Education. Last November, the second and third one-week advanced courses for teachers and principals were conducted in the national office by Dr Laura Ticciati and Dr Annie Balkema, 'great leaders of Consciousness-Based Education and master trainers in this field', he said.

In 2012 all principals and senior teachers from all branches of the school will attend another one-week advanced training course, which will also be conducted by Dr Ticciati and Dr Balkema.

To give better theoretical training and practical experience of Maharishi's Vedic Science and its technologies of consciousness, the Maharishi Vidya Mandir organization invited all of its teachers to attend a one-week residential course at the Bijauri campus at the Brahmasthan. Over 800 teachers participated in April, May, and June in 10 different groups, and about 150 more participated in July in two more groups.

Many teachers commented on their enjoyment of this course, and the great fulfilment they found in deepening their knowledge and experience of Maharishi's Vedic Science in the beautiful and profound atmosphere at the Brahmasthan.

In the current academic year, Maharishi Vidya Mandir Schools has organized seven subject teacher seminars and workshops. One hundred twenty eight teachers have participated and refreshed their knowledge of their respective disciplines, and updated their skills with new teaching methodologies. These seminars and workshops have proven very useful for teachers and students and helped them to maintain very high academic standards in their schools.

This year Maharishi Vidya Mandir Schools has completed construction of 21 school buildings, and started construction of 28 new buildings. All these buildings include halls for faculty, staff, and students for the group practice of Transcendental Meditation and its advanced techniques, including Yogic Flying. Maharishi Vidya Mandir Schools group has also completed 17 new school books of arts, crafts, computer, and Sanskrit.
